   The orifice flowmeter uses a unique anti-freeze blocker. When measuring steam, it does not need heat, heat preservation and condenser, which greatly simplifies the layout and facilitates field equipment. Not only does it save a lot of power, but the flowmeter maintenance is greatly reduced. In the traditional orifice flowmeter , in order to condense the steam in the pressure guiding tube and make the condensate surface in the positive and negative pressure guiding tubes have equal heights, and maintain stability, both in the positive and negative pressure guiding pipelines Each is equipped with a condenser. In order to ensure the normal operation of the differential pressure transmitter in the cold environment, it is also necessary to be equipped with heat-insulating insulation equipment, which has a large layout and waste of power.

The fluid filled in the orifice flowmeter pipe, when they flow through the saving device in the pipeline, the flow beam will be partially shortened in the saving part of the saving device, so that the flow rate is increased, the static pressure is low, so it occurs before and after saving the piece. The pressure drop, that is, the pressure difference, the greater the flow rate of the medium activity, the greater the pressure difference that occurs before and after the saving of the piece, so the orifice flow meter can measure the pressure difference to measure the flow rate. This measurement method is based on the law of energy conservation and the law of activity continuity.

   Orifice flowmeter, also known as differential pressure flowmeter, consists of primary and secondary equipment and is widely used for flow measurement of gases, vapors and liquids. It has the characteristics of simple layout, convenient repair, unchanged function, and firm use. The orifice plate saver is installed inside the pipeline. Since the aperture of the saving member is smaller than the inner diameter of the pipeline, when the fluid flows through the saving member, the cross section of the stream is shortened and the flow velocity is accelerated. The static pressure drop of the fluid at the back end of the piece is saved, so that a static pressure difference occurs before and after the saving piece, and the static pressure difference and the fluid flow rate of the fluid have a determined value contact and fit.

The equipment is widely used in process control and measurement in petroleum, chemical, metallurgy, electric power, heating, water supply and other fields.
